Varicose veins – those gnarly, bulging veins that are visible through the skin.  They cause pain, leg fatigue, and swelling.  The valves in those veins stop functioning and pushing blood back to the heart like they are supposed to do.  The blood pools in the veins causing more and more symptoms over time.
